1. Pure Dye Sources
Pure dye sources are basic to reaching vibrant colours on eggs with out artificial colorants. The particular dye materials instantly influences the ensuing hue. As an example, purple onion skins impart a wealthy reddish-brown, whereas yellow onion skins yield a heat golden tone. Beets produce shades of pink and magenta, whereas turmeric creates a vibrant yellow. The depth of the colour depends upon components such because the focus of the dye tub and the period of the dyeing course of. Understanding the colour spectrum supplied by varied pure sources permits for deliberate shade decisions and inventive experimentation.
The effectiveness of pure dyes might be enhanced by getting ready the dye tub appropriately. Chopping or grinding the dye materials will increase the floor space, facilitating pigment launch. Simmering the dye materials in water extracts the colour compounds, making a concentrated dye tub. Including a mordant, comparable to vinegar or alum, helps repair the dye to the eggshells, leading to extra vibrant and longer-lasting colours. Totally different mordants may subtly alter the ultimate hue, including one other layer of complexity to the dyeing course of. For instance, utilizing iron as a mordant with sure dyes can create darker, virtually grey-black tones.

3. Vinegar or mordant
Mordants play a vital function in pure egg dyeing, appearing as a bridge between the dye and the eggshell. They improve the dye’s capability to bond with the calcium carbonate of the shell, leading to richer, extra vibrant colours and improved colorfastness. Whereas vinegar, a gentle acid, serves as a available mordant, different pure substances like salt, alum, or iron sulfate supply various choices, every influencing the ultimate shade end result.
-
Vinegar as a Mordant
White vinegar, available in most kitchens, acts as a gentle acidic mordant. The acetic acid in vinegar helps to etch the eggshell floor microscopically, permitting the dye to penetrate and cling extra successfully. This leads to brighter colours and reduces shade bleeding. Whereas efficient, vinegar’s impression on shade alteration is minimal in comparison with different mordants.
-
Alum (Potassium Aluminum Sulfate)
Alum, a generally used mordant in pure dyeing, creates a chemical bond between the dye and the fiber (on this case, the eggshell). This bond considerably improves colorfastness and sometimes leads to brighter, clearer hues. Alum is available on-line or in some grocery shops.
-
Iron Sulfate
Iron sulfate acts as a metallic mordant, reacting with sure dyes to create darker, extra muted shades. It could actually shift colours in direction of gray, brown, and even black, relying on the dye used. This mordant permits for exploring a special vary of shade prospects in comparison with vinegar or alum.
-
Salt
Whereas not a mordant within the conventional sense, salt can improve the saturation and depth of sure pure dyes, notably these derived from berries. It aids within the extraction of shade pigments and promotes higher absorption by the eggshell. Nevertheless, salt’s effectiveness varies relying on the particular dye used. It usually works finest together with different mordants like vinegar.

4. Warmth management
Warmth management performs a vital function in extracting vibrant colours from pure dyes and successfully transferring these colours onto eggshells. Temperature influences the chemical reactions concerned in dye extraction and binding, instantly impacting the ultimate shade depth and evenness. Making use of extreme warmth can degrade sure pigments, resulting in uninteresting or muddy hues, whereas inadequate warmth might end in weak shade saturation. The fragile steadiness of sustaining optimum temperature all through the dyeing course of is important for reaching desired outcomes.
For instance, when utilizing purple onion skins to realize a deep reddish-brown shade, a delicate simmer relatively than a rolling boil extracts the colour compounds extra successfully. Boiling can break down the specified pigments, leading to a much less vibrant and doubtlessly browner hue. Conversely, when dyeing with turmeric for a vibrant yellow, a better temperature might be useful for extracting the colourful curcuminoids, however extended publicity to excessive warmth can nonetheless result in shade degradation. Understanding the optimum temperature vary for every pure dye supply is essential for maximizing shade vibrancy.
Efficient warmth management entails sustaining a constant temperature all through the dyeing course of. This may be achieved by means of varied strategies, together with utilizing a double boiler or a low-heat setting on a stovetop. Monitoring the temperature with a thermometer ensures precision and repeatability. Cautious warmth administration prevents scorching the dye supplies and safeguards the integrity of the eggshells, notably when working with delicate blown-out eggs. 5. Dyeing time
Dyeing time is a vital consider reaching desired shade saturation and vibrancy when utilizing pure dyes on eggs. The period of immersion within the dye tub instantly influences the depth of the colour absorbed by the eggshell. Understanding the connection between dyeing time and shade growth permits for exact management over the ultimate hue, starting from refined pastels to deep, wealthy tones. Cautious administration of dyeing time is important for reaching particular shade targets and making certain constant outcomes.
-
Brief Dyeing Occasions (e.g., 15-Half-hour)
Shorter dyeing occasions usually end in lighter, extra delicate pastel shades. That is excellent for reaching refined hues or when utilizing extremely potent dyes. Temporary immersion intervals enable for a gradual shade buildup, providing larger management over the ultimate shade depth. For instance, dipping eggs in a beet dye tub for quarter-hour may produce a tender pink, whereas Half-hour may yield a deeper rose shade.
-
Medium Dyeing Occasions (e.g., 1-2 hours)
Medium dyeing occasions usually produce extra vibrant and saturated colours. This period permits for adequate dye absorption to realize richer hues with out over-dyeing. As an example, soaking eggs in an onion pores and skin dye tub for an hour may end in a golden yellow, whereas two hours may deepen the colour to a wealthy orange-brown.
-
Lengthy Dyeing Occasions (e.g., 4+ hours or in a single day)
Longer dyeing occasions, usually extending to a number of hours or in a single day, are employed for reaching deep, intense colours. This extended immersion permits for max dye absorption, leading to wealthy, jewel-toned hues. Nevertheless, prolonged dyeing occasions require cautious monitoring to stop over-dyeing, which might result in muddy or uneven coloration. Dyeing eggs in a powerful turmeric resolution in a single day, as an example, can produce a deep, vibrant gold.
-
Elements Influencing Dyeing Time
A number of components past the specified shade depth affect the optimum dyeing time. The kind of dye used, the focus of the dye tub, the temperature of the dye tub, and the porosity of the eggshell all contribute to the speed of dye absorption. For instance, extremely porous eggshells may soak up dye extra rapidly than denser shells, requiring shorter dyeing occasions to realize related shade saturation. 9. Inventive Designs
Inventive designs elevate naturally dyed eggs from easy, monochromatic objects to intricate artistic endeavors. The combination of design parts enhances the visible enchantment and permits for personalised expression. Methods employed earlier than, throughout, and after the dyeing course of considerably impression the ultimate design end result. Pre-dyeing strategies, comparable to wax resist or wrapping with pure supplies, set up patterns and textures. Variations in dyeing time and dye focus create gradients and layered results. Submit-dyeing elaborations, like etching or including ornamental parts, additional improve the design complexity. The interaction of those strategies permits for a variety of artistic prospects, remodeling the eggs into distinctive, personalised creations.
For instance, making use of melted beeswax to the eggshell earlier than dyeing creates a batik-like impact. The wax resists the dye, leaving the coated areas of their unique shade whereas the uncovered areas soak up the dye. Intricate patterns might be achieved utilizing instruments like a kistka, a conventional wax-writing software, or perhaps a easy toothpick. Alternatively, wrapping leaves, flowers, or lace tightly in opposition to the eggshell earlier than dyeing imparts pure impressions onto the dyed floor. These pre-dyeing strategies introduce a component of unpredictability, including to the creative allure of the ultimate product. Submit-dyeing, strategies like gently scraping the eggshell with a pointy software reveal the underlying shell shade, creating intricate etched designs. Ideas for Vibrant Pure Egg Colours
Attaining vibrant colours by means of pure dyeing requires consideration to element and an understanding of the components influencing dye uptake and colorfastness. The next ideas present sensible steering for maximizing shade vibrancy and reaching desired outcomes.
Tip 1: Prioritize white eggs. White eggshells present a impartial canvas, permitting the pure dyes to shine by means of with larger readability and vibrancy. Brown eggs, whereas usable, have a tendency to supply extra muted tones attributable to their inherent pigmentation.
Tip 2: Totally clear eggshells earlier than dyeing. Clear eggshells guarantee even dye absorption and stop blotchy or uneven coloration. Mild scrubbing with heat water and a tender fabric or brush removes filth and oils that may intrude with dye uptake.
Tip 3: Make use of a mordant to reinforce colorfastness. Mordants, comparable to vinegar, alum, or iron sulfate, assist bind the dye to the eggshell, leading to richer, extra vibrant colours and improved shade retention. Totally different mordants may subtly alter the ultimate hue, providing additional artistic prospects.
Tip 4: Use a devoted stainless-steel or glass pot for dyeing. Keep away from utilizing reactive cookware, comparable to aluminum or forged iron, as these supplies can work together with the dyes and alter the colours. Chrome steel or glass ensures the integrity of the dye tub and prevents undesirable chemical reactions.
Tip 5: Experiment with dye focus and dyeing time. Shade depth correlates instantly with dye focus and immersion time. Stronger dye options and longer dyeing occasions end in deeper, extra vibrant hues. Experimentation permits for exact management over the ultimate shade end result.
Tip 6: Preserve constant warmth management in the course of the dyeing course of. Mild simmering, relatively than boiling, extracts shade compounds extra successfully and prevents pigment degradation. Constant warmth ensures even dye uptake and prevents scorching the dye supplies.
Tip 7: Contemplate pure design parts for added visible curiosity. Wrapping eggs with leaves, flowers, or rubber bands earlier than dyeing creates distinctive patterns and textures. Wax resist strategies supply additional artistic prospects for intricate designs.
Tip 8: Deal with dyed eggs gently and retailer them correctly. Cautious dealing with after dyeing prevents smudging and preserves the vibrancy of the colours. Mild rinsing, patting dry with a tender fabric, and storing in a cool, dry place maintains shade depth.
